相关文章

数据结构:选择排序(Python实现)

选择排序原理不在这里详细讲 #非稳定排序算法 def select_sort(shuzu):nlen(shuzu)for i in range(n-1):minifor j in range(i1,n):if shuzu[j]<shuzu[min]:minjshuzu[min],shuzu[i]shuzu[i],shuzu[min]return shuzu import timeif __name____main__:t1 time.time()a [1,…

五、Golang 中的数组Array以及Slice底层实现

1、Array(数组) 数组是指一系列同一类型数据的集合。数组中包含的每个数据被称为数组元素 (element),这种类型可以是任意的原始类型,比如 int 、 string 等,也可以是用户自定义的类型。一个数组包含的元素个数被称为数组的长度。 在 Golang 中数组是一个长度固定的数据类…

「C++系列」数组

前些天发现了一个巨牛的人工智能学习网站&#xff0c;通俗易懂&#xff0c;风趣幽默&#xff0c;忍不住分享一下给大家。点击跳转到网站&#xff1a;人工智能教程 文章目录 一、数组1. 声明数组2. 初始化数组3. 访问数组元素4. 遍历数组注意事项示例代码 二、多维数组1. 声明二…

Java方法

1.方法 在各个语言中实际上都是由函数的定义&#xff0c;那么函数在Java中被称为方法。 2.方法的基本概念 在程序中&#xff0c;如果某一段代码需要被重复调用的时候&#xff0c;就可以通过方法来完成&#xff0c;但是由于现在的方法是采用主方法直接调用的形式完成的&#xf…

Shell ${!shuzu[@]} 获取数组的所有下标

在shell脚本中&#xff0c;数组是经常用到的。有时&#xff0c;数组中元数的个数是不确定的。 我们知道&#xff0c;获取数组的元素个数&#xff1a;${#array[]}&#xff1b;获取数组的所有元素${array[*]}。 那么有没有办法直接获取数组的所有下标呢&#xff1f;${!shuzu[]} …

数组

数组 3.14.什么是数组&#xff1f; 相同数据类型的数据按照顺序组成的复合数据类型就是数组。 1.相同数据类型的数据----将来被保存到数组中的数据都是同一类型。【男澡堂子里都是男的】 2.按照顺序 3.复合数据类型 3.15.如何定义一个一维数组&#xff1f; 格式: 数据类型 …

Allegro 17.2 xnet设置不成功解决方法

Allegro 17.2 xnet设置不成功解决方法 ALLEGRO 17.2 XNET设置不成功解决方法 1 ALLEGRO 17.2 XNET设置不成功 新建PCB设置成功。导出约束文件&#xff0c;对比设置差异。 发现有问题的PCB&#xff0c;XNetsDMLOn没有设置。 2 解决方法 将正常的约束文件导出&#xff0c;导…

Allegro XNET,RePP,MGrP的关系

1、建立MGrP时&#xff0c;会发现有个XNET下有多个RePP(XNET本身就是多个网络的组合)&#xff1b; 解决方法 1.1 XNET建立(Repp)pin pair... 关系 1.2 选择你需要的点到点 网络关系&#xff1b; 1.3 将你需要的Repp 添加到MGrP,而不是将这个XNET添加到MGrP。 您明白了吗&…

xNet 项目推荐

xNet 项目推荐 xNet xNet - class library for .NET Framework 项目地址: https://gitcode.com/gh_mirrors/xn/xNet 1. 项目基础介绍和主要编程语言 xNet 是一个基于 .NET Framework 的类库项目&#xff0c;主要使用 C# 编程语言开发。该项目旨在为开发者提供一套强大的…

Cadence Allegro PCB设计88问解析(六) 之 Allegro中的XNet设置

一个学习信号完整性仿真的layout工程师 在我们的进行layout设计时&#xff0c;尤其是在一些差分走线上&#xff0c;经常会遇到串联电阻或者电容的情况&#xff0c;可能在信号速率不高或者spec要求不严格时&#xff0c;我们会忽略独立器件另一端较短走线的长度延时&#xff0c;但…

探索NI-XNET:汽车网络测试与仿真的利器

探索NI-XNET&#xff1a;汽车网络测试与仿真的利器 【下载地址】NI-XNET样例程序 本仓库提供了NI-XNET设备的样例程序。NI-XNET为配置、开发和调试应用程序提供支持&#xff0c;适用于汽车以太网、CAN、LIN和FlexRay网络的原型验证、仿真和测试。NI-XNET是一个NI仪器驱动程序&a…

allegro中Xnet设置与删除(包括多引脚元器件模型Xnet设置)

allegro中Xnet设置 1、打开allegro->Analyze->Mode Assigment,如图 弹出框点击ok-> 点击是&#xff0c;弹出如下页面&#xff0c;就是要设置的Xnet 模型的页面&#xff1a; 2、在Refdes中输出你要创建Xnet模型的元器件即可&#xff1b;例如如下输入一个电阻&#x…

Allegro17.2不能创建XNET的解决办法

本文来自Cadence官方论坛的网络回复&#xff0c;本文改为中文和配图。 1、打开ENV&#xff0c;增加set CDS_XNET_STATE_UI1&#xff1b; 2、重新打开Allegro和规则管理其器&#xff1b; 3、从规则管理器 Tools > Options 选择 “Create XNets and Differential Pairs usin…

Allegro中设置Xnet等长

过电阻的等长线设置 1. 红色圈圈内的图标就是规则管理器&#xff0c;点击打开 我们可以看到这样&#xff1a;等长线规则在Relative Propagation Delay(相对传播延时) 我们发现所有的网络属性都是Net&#xff0c;如果我们想要过电阻等长布线&#xff0c;则需要将高速信号的网络建…

记录:Allegro无法删除元器件XNET属性

最近在画板时发现导入到PCB中的很多元器件自带了XNET属性&#xff0c;搞不清楚怎么添加的&#xff0c;但是确定不是自己主动添加的&#xff0c;网上找了很多方法均无效果&#xff0c;现在暂时记录一下 在allegro的分析菜单&#xff08;Analyze&#xff09;里面的的Mode Assignm…

01-Cadence17.4差分组内Xnet的创建与等长布线

Cadence17.4差分组内Xnet的创建与等长布线 1.原理图说明 1.如下图所示&#xff0c;原理图在设计时会有过电容的差分线&#xff0c;我以USB3.0的TX引脚为例&#xff0c;其线上有100nF的耦合电容&#xff0c;另外两组线是U3的RX引脚和U2的数据引脚。 2.以上三对线呢假设需要组内…

使用NI-XNET去测试CAN通信

大家好&#xff0c;我最近正在做一个测试&#xff0c;就是我在matlab里面用了CAN pack这个模块&#xff0c;将dbc文件放进去了。然后我就生成代码&#xff0c;导入到veristand里面了&#xff0c;然后这个模型我不知道怎么和veristand里XNET的CAN进行mapping&#xff0c; 我就是…

Allegro如何取消Xnet操作指导

在实际Layout过程中&#xff0c;差分对上往往串接有电阻&#xff0c;电容或共模电感。这时候就需要创建Xnet。那么Allegro如何创建Xnet呢&#xff1f; 1、点击菜单 Analyze&#xff08;分析&#xff09;→Model Assigment&#xff08;模型分配&#xff09;&#xff0c;如下图所…

allegro 删除默认生成的xnet

在orcad中画好原理图&#xff0c;同步到pcb后&#xff0c;查看引脚时&#xff0c;发现会出现一些xnet&#xff0c;但有的xnet我们并不需要&#xff0c;比如我这里的SCKN与SCKP的差分时钟信号之间并联了一个电阻&#xff0c;而它自动把他们俩识别成了一个xnet&#xff0c;导致我…

Allegro如何创建Xnet操作指导

在实际Layout过程中,差分对上往往串接有电阻,电容或共模电感。这时候就需要创建Xnet。那么Allegro如何创建Xnet呢? 具体操作如下: 1、点击菜单 Analyze(分析)→Model Assigment(模型分配),如下图所示 2、跳出SI Design Audit对话框,直接点OK,如下图所示 3、接着跳出…